New York City 1-Day Hop-on Hop-off with Empire State and Statue of Liberty Ferry

Overview
With a 1-day Big Bus ticket to New York City, you can follow two hop-on hop-off routes—downtown and uptown. In addition, gain entry to the 86th-floor observation deck at the Empire State Building and enjoy convenient transport service to Ellis Island and the Statue of Liberty National Monument via round-trip ferry. Rather than booking separately, save time and money with one ticket.

- Board a hop-on hop-off Big Bus at any stop along two routes
- Explore the sights of downtown and uptown Manhattan
- Admission ticket to the Empire State Building observation deck included
- Travel round-trip by ferry to Ellis Island and Liberty Island

  • Tickets claimed after 3pm are valid for the next day
  • The Statue of Liberty & Ellis Island Ferry operates from 9:00am to 3:00pm with regular departures from Battery Park. You will need to redeem your ticket voucher with a Big Bus Tours staff member before heading to the ferry terminal
  • This ticket includes a ferry journey to both Liberty Island and Ellis Island, but not interior monument or museum access.

Hop on Hop off Bus tours is, in my opinion, the best way to tour NYC or any other major city. You can get on when and where you want, stay as long or as little as you like and get off wherever you choose. If you have a multi day pass and don't want to take the time to study the route map you can get on and just stay on the bus till you get back to where you started. You can then determine where you want to go (and what you want to pass on) then schedule your time accordingly. Hopefully the weather will be good (not our case) in which case if it is raining you will want to either have a good raincoat and umbrella (transparent best for this case) or stay in the lower level. The guide will give you full details along the route and at every stop. My apologies for no pictures from the bus as I did not want to get my canon 7d MKII wet.

Don’t normally review bus tours but felt needed to on this occasion, mainly as standard differed so much: Downtown red loop - guides great, really informative and knowledgeable. Statue of Liberty cruise - great trip, informative and interesting. Downtown red loop/Brooklyn - guide kept missing landmarks, felt like we were looking back over our shoulders all the time. Brooklyn guide was good but not much to see other than the Manhattan skyline. Harlem - interesting and informative, good tour guide. Uptown blue loop - guide was useless (blond bloke), think he was auditioning for a game show. Made sarcastic comments as we left about a tip, he was hopeless. Would still recommend these bus trips as you get to see main sights and then work out where you want to go but the differing levels of knowledge by guides can affect your experience.
